Innovative Users Group Southern Africa
Referred to as IUG-SA. The purpose of IUG-SA shall be to:
- Encourage the sharing of ideas and the optimum use of the Innovative systems among the users
- Build relationships among the IUG-SA members
- Promote communication among the IUG-SA members
- Convene an annual workshop for the discussion of new developments and resolution of problems experienced with the Innovative systems
Membership
Any library in Southern Africa using the automated library systems and products of Innovative Interfaces Inc. is eligible to become a member of the IUG-SA. Register here.
Innovative User Group (IUG)
The parent Innovative Users Group (IUG) has been an independent organization since 1993. They are dedicated to serve as a forum for new and experienced users of products and services developed at Innovative Interfaces.
Their shared ideals are that all participants should be able to freely and openly share ideas in a friendly, safe, and welcoming environment that encourages and inspires mutual respect, consideration and collaboration.
